Grant select on schema to role

WebSep 16, 2024 · Existing Tables: Before learning how to work with future tables, let us first understand how granting priviledges works on existing tables. Since each table belongs … WebApr 21, 2024 · If there are not too many schemas, something like GRANT USAGE ON SCHEMA schemaX to myrole; GRANT SELECT ON ALL TABLES IN SCHEMA schemaX to myrole; is pretty efficient. To handle future schemas & tables, use: ALTER DEFAULT PRIVILEGES GRANT USAGE ON SCHEMAS to [YOUR_ROLE or YOUR_USER];

GRANT Schema Permissions (Transact-SQL) - SQL Server

WebApr 10, 2024 · But I though whether could exist a more straightforward way for granting only on the tables like this: my_schema: +schema: my_schema +grants: select: [ 'REPORTER' ] type: table intermediate: materialized: view # ROLE2'd not be revoked in views in this case. permissions. snowflake-cloud-data-platform. dbt. Share. WebOct 7, 2024 · You could GRANT schema permissions that are effective for everything existing and everything that will exist in that schema. GRANT SELECT, INSERT, UPDATE, DELETE ON SCHEMA :: TO ; Further to that, if you want to then deny permissions on a certain object within that schema, you can do. how is money created out of thin air https://b2galliance.com

GRANT-DENY-REVOKE permissions - Azure Synapse Analytics

WebFeb 9, 2024 · Description. The GRANT command has two basic variants: one that grants privileges on a database object (table, column, view, foreign table, sequence, database, … WebA schema is a security domain that can contain database objects. Privileges granted to users and roles control access to these database objects. ... For example, to grant the hr_admin role SELECT, INSERT, UPDATE, and DELETE privileges on the HR.EMPLOYEES table, you enter the following statement: WebJan 5, 2016 · To simplify a bit further, you can use roles to do the job that you are looking for. Once you assign permissions to the role, you can just add users to the role. ... GO -- … how is money debt

How to set up access control for your Azure Synapse workspace

Category:GRANT Object Permissions (Transact-SQL) - SQL Server

Tags:Grant select on schema to role

Grant select on schema to role

How to GRANT privileges to a ROLE on an Oracle SCHEMA

WebApr 10, 2024 · That will not only add the radio schema to the the search_path, it will rearrange the order on the search_path so that the radio schema is searched before the public schema. If you disconnect and come back to the connection, you will have to reset the path when using the SET command.. If you want to make the changes to the path the … WebFeb 28, 2024 · We can now create the role Supervisor and assign it read privileges on the schema Finance: CREATE ROLE [Supervisor]; GRANT SELECT ON schema :: Finance to Supervisor; Very easy! Notice the different syntax vs. a normal GRANT. In this case, we must specify ON SCHEMA :: instead of simply putting in the name of the object.

Grant select on schema to role

Did you know?

WebGranting SELECTIN allows you to select from tables defined in the schema. The following authorities cannot be granted to the special group PUBLIC: SCHEMAADM on the schema; ACCESSCTRL on the schema; DATAACCESS on the schema ; ... GRANT ROLE role-name TO ROLE role-name2 WebFeb 9, 2024 · The GRANT command has two basic variants: one that grants privileges on a database object (table, column, view, foreign table, sequence, database, foreign-data wrapper, foreign server, function, procedure, procedural language, schema, or tablespace), and one that grants membership in a role.

WebTo grant the OWNERSHIP privilege on an object (or all objects of a specified type in a schema) to a role, transferring ownership of the object from one role to another role, use GRANT OWNERSHIP instead. The GRANT OWNERSHIP command has a different syntax. WebOct 10, 2010 · sudo -u postgres psql -H 10.10.10.10 -p 5432 -d service_db -U admin service_db=# service_db=#select * from service_schema.customers; permission denied While connecting and executing the command from Netbeans: select * from service_schema.customers; ... GRANT USAGE ON SCHEMA ...

WebThe GRANT statement enables system administrators to grant privileges and roles, which can be granted to user accounts and roles. These syntax restrictions apply: GRANT cannot mix granting both privileges and roles in the same statement. A given GRANT statement must grant either privileges or roles. Webgrant select on all tables in schema qa_tickit to fred; The following example grants all schema privileges on the schema QA_TICKIT to the user group QA_USERS. Schema privileges are CREATE and USAGE. USAGE grants users access to the objects in the schema, but doesn't grant privileges such as INSERT or SELECT on those objects.

WebOct 13, 2014 · GRANT SELECT on all tables in a schema Tmicheli-Oracle Oct 13 2014 — edited Jun 26 2024 User often are asking for a single statement to Grant privileges in a single step. there are multiple workarounds for not have a GRANT SELECT on all table FOR x IN (SELECT * FROM user_tables) LOOP

WebSep 9, 2009 · Hi use command GRANT select ON OBJECT::schema_name.table_name TO uer_name; note: to do the opeation, you should have the membership in the … highlands of greenvillage chambersburg paWebSep 16, 2024 · Grant SELECT privilege on all tables for a particular schema: use role accountadmin; grant usage on database MY_DB to role TEST_ROLE; grant usage on schema MY_DB.MY_SCHEMA to role TEST_ROLE; grant select on all tables in schema MY_DB.MY_SCHEMA to role TEST_ROLE; Grant SELECT privilege on all tables for a … highlands of innisbrook hoaWebJun 3, 2024 · 1.1.2. Execute READ_ONLY_TEST.sql: Open file READ_ONLY_TEST.sql in the editor and remove first line (select command) and last line (spool off;) and save then execute it. 1.1.3. … highlands of innisbrookWebNov 1, 2012 · Right click on the Security node in the Object Explorer and select New Database Role. In the Database Role - New window, type the name of the role and the owner. At this point, you should be able to script the creation of the role. Select type of objects you want to set permissions for. how is money freedomWebApr 26, 2024 · USAGE allows a role to use a schema; you will need to grant this to any roles that wish to query the schema. CREATE also exists on the schema level. You will need to assign this to all the roles for the schemas within the databases I just mentioned above. ... SELECT allows a role to select from a table or view. You will want to assign … highlands of flower moundWebFor example, the following statements grant different privileges on objects of the same type at the database and schema levels. Grant the SELECT privilege on all future schemas … how is money laundered in ozarkWebMar 3, 2024 · The name of the login, database, table, view, schema, procedure, role, or user on which to grant, deny, or revoke permissions. The object name can be specified with the three-part naming rules that are described in Transact-SQL syntax conventions. One or more principals being granted, denied, or revoked permissions. highlands of iceland windows 10 backgrounds